Brief summary

The purpose of this study was to determine the safety and efficacy of ACH-0144471 (also known as danicopan and ALXN2040) in currently untreated participants with PNH.

Detailed description

After 12 weeks of treatment, participants deriving clinical benefit were offered enrollment in a separate long-term extension study (ACH471-103, NCT03181633).

Interventions

DRUGDanicopan

Danicopan was administered as multiple oral doses over a period of at least 28 days.

Inclusion criteria

* Currently untreated PNH participants with PNH Type III erythrocyte and/or granulocyte clone size ≥10% and anemia (hemoglobin \<12 grams/deciliter) with adequate reticulocytosis (as determined by the Investigator). * LDH ≥1.5 x the upper limit of normal. * Platelets ≥50,000/microliter without the need for platelet transfusions. * Documentation of vaccination for Neisseria meningitidis, Haemophilus influenza, and Streptococcus pneumoniae, or willingness to receive vaccinations during the screening period. * Negative pregnancy test for females prior to dosing and throughout the study.

Exclusion criteria

* History of a major organ transplant (for example, heart, lung, kidney, liver) or hematopoietic stem cell/marrow transplant. * Participants who had received another investigational agent within 30 days or 5 half-lives of the investigational agent prior to study entry, whichever is greater. * Participants who had received eculizumab at any dose or interval within the past 75 days before study entry. * Participants with known or suspected complement deficiency. * Participants with active bacterial infection or clinically significant active viral infection, a body temperature \>38°Celsius, or other evidence of infection on Day 1, or with a history of febrile illness within 14 days prior to first study drug administration. * History of meningococcal infection, or a first-degree relative or household contact with a history of meningococcal infection. * Females who were pregnant, nursing, or planning to become pregnant during the study or within 90 days of study drug administration or participants with a female partner who was pregnant, nursing, or planning to become pregnant during the study or within 90 days of study drug administration.

Participant flow

Pre-assignment details

The study was conducted in 2 parts. In Part 1, participants received danicopan for 28 days. Starting doses were 100 or 150 milligrams (mg) three times daily (TID). A further dose increase up to 175 mg TID (N=8 participants) and 200 mg TID (N=4 participants) was conducted. Participants with reductions in lactate dehydrogenase (LDH) meeting specified criteria were offered continued dosing beyond Day 28, for up to 8 additional weeks (Part 2).

Outcome results

Primary

Change From Baseline In Serum LDH Levels At Day 28

Change from Baseline = Serum LDH levels on Day 28 - Baseline Serum LDH levels.

Time frame: Baseline, Day 28

Population: All participants who received at least 1 dose of study drug and had analyzable data at the timepoints specified.

ArmMeasureGroupValue (MEAN)Dispersion
DanicopanChange From Baseline In Serum LDH Levels At Day 28Change from Baseline-971.7 international units per liter (IU/L)Standard Deviation 549.76
DanicopanChange From Baseline In Serum LDH Levels At Day 28Baseline1416 international units per liter (IU/L)Standard Deviation 540.25
DanicopanChange From Baseline In Serum LDH Levels At Day 28Day 28 (Part 1)444.3 international units per liter (IU/L)Standard Deviation 255.78
Secondary

Change From Baseline In Hemoglobin (Hgb) At Days 28 And 84

Change from Baseline = Hgb levels on Days 28 or 84 - Baseline Hgb levels.

Time frame: Baseline, Days 28 and 84

Population: All participants who received at least 1 dose of study drug and had analyzable data at the timepoints specified.

ArmMeasureGroupValue (MEAN)Dispersion
DanicopanChange From Baseline In Hemoglobin (Hgb) At Days 28 And 84Baseline9.76 grams/deciliter (g/dL)Standard Deviation 1.758
DanicopanChange From Baseline In Hemoglobin (Hgb) At Days 28 And 84Part 1: Day 2810.94 grams/deciliter (g/dL)Standard Deviation 1.651
DanicopanChange From Baseline In Hemoglobin (Hgb) At Days 28 And 84Part 1: Change from Baseline at Day 281.18 grams/deciliter (g/dL)Standard Deviation 0.877
DanicopanChange From Baseline In Hemoglobin (Hgb) At Days 28 And 84Part 2: Day 8411.45 grams/deciliter (g/dL)Standard Deviation 1.414
DanicopanChange From Baseline In Hemoglobin (Hgb) At Days 28 And 84Part 2: Change from Baseline at Day 841.80 grams/deciliter (g/dL)Standard Deviation 1.166
